Yuping Zhou is a scholar working on Oceanography, Ecology and Spectroscopy. According to data from OpenAlex, Yuping Zhou has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 821 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Oceanography, 14 papers in Ecology and 9 papers in Spectroscopy. Recurrent topics in Yuping Zhou’s work include Marine and coastal ecosystems (14 papers), Marine Biology and Ecology Research (12 papers) and Isotope Analysis in Ecology (9 papers). Yuping Zhou is often cited by papers focused on Marine and coastal ecosystems (14 papers), Marine Biology and Ecology Research (12 papers) and Isotope Analysis in Ecology (9 papers). Yuping Zhou coll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Yuping Zhou's co-authors include Richard W. Vachet, Ding He, Yunming Fang, Liju Tan, Jin-Wu Jiang, Quan Shi, Jiangtao Wang, Chen He, Yuntao Wang and Penghui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, Water Research and The Science of The Total Environment.
